Interventions
Learn about the drugs, procedures, or behavioral strategies being tested and how they are applied within this trial.
oxygen
cylinder and concentrator, dosage to maintain SpO2 above 92%, used during exertion
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* dyspnea limiting daily activities
* desaturation less than or equal to 88% for 2 continuous minutes during a room air six-minute walk test
Exclusion Criteria
* those who met criteria for mortality reduction with long-term oxygen
* those who received oxygen for palliative care or isolated nocturnal hypoxemia
* those unable to complete the questionnaires or provide informed consent
